Empty Bowls is a nationwide event to help feed the hungry. This year the potters of Art Center Manatee are making seven hundred bowls. The community is invited to help with glazing on Tuesday Oct 10, 17 and 24 from 11-1 or 5-7.  Call 941-746-2862 for information and to reserve your glazing time. The Empty Bowls event is in November and your help now is appreciated.

David Piurek works as a conservation technician at the Ringling Museum and is responsible for much of the work in the restored Asolo theatre. Piruek is exhibiting at Greene Contemporary, a dozen still life pieces inspired by the tradition of Dutch Still Life and, in particular, a piece hanging at Ringling by Willem van der Ast. The playwright/screenwriter, David Mamet, who brought us "Wag The Dog," "State & Main," and "Speed," is back with a new farce-yes, farce. This new, biting comedy-which has nothing and everything to do with romance-tells a courtroom story. The defendant has the secret to peace in the Middle East, but bureaucracy is keeping him from getting across town to the ongoing peace conference. Some of the wackiest, most fascinating characters you'll ever meet in a play make this a soon-to-be classic. Strong language, not recommended for children or pre-teens. Directed by Murray Chase at the Venice Little Theatre.
